Which statement about chlamydia is true?
A. It is caused by a virus.
B. Among U.S. 15- to 19-year-olds, chlamydia cases are more common than human papillomavirus (HPV) cases.
C. No effective treatments exist for chlamydia, although some drugs can reduce symptoms of the disease.
D. It often has no symptoms but can lead to infertility and sterility if left untreated.
Answer: D
